springboot 数据库生成配置文件
时间: 2023-10-14 22:28:33 浏览: 49
在Spring Boot中,可以通过配置文件来配置数据库连接信息。常用的配置文件有application.properties和application.yml。
以下是application.properties的配置示例,其中的${}表示占位符,需要替换成具体的值:
```
# 数据库驱动
spring.datasource.driver-class-name=com.mysql.cj.jdbc.Driver
# 数据库连接url
spring.datasource.url=jdbc:mysql://${mysql.host}:${mysql.port}/${mysql.database}?serverTimezone=UTC&useUnicode=true&characterEncoding=UTF-8
# 数据库用户名
spring.datasource.username=${mysql.username}
# 数据库密码
spring.datasource.password=${mysql.password}
```
以下是application.yml的配置示例:
```
spring:
datasource:
driver-class-name: com.mysql.cj.jdbc.Driver
url: jdbc:mysql://${mysql.host}:${mysql.port}/${mysql.database}?serverTimezone=UTC&useUnicode=true&characterEncoding=UTF-8
username: ${mysql.username}
password: ${mysql.password}
```
其中,${}同样表示占位符,需要替换成具体的值。
在以上配置中,需要替换的值包括:
- mysql.host:MySQL数据库所在的主机名或IP地址;
- mysql.port:MySQL数据库监听的端口号;
- mysql.database:要连接的数据库名称;
- mysql.username:要连接的数据库用户名;
- mysql.password:要连接的数据库密码。
替换成具体的值后,即可使用Spring Boot自动配置的数据源来连接数据库。